Bjorn Wiinblad for Rosenthal, 1960s small porcelain vase. Studio-line Germany, Arundo vintage vase. Commedia dell' Arte series, musicians

A small white porcelain vase, produced by Rosenthal Studio-Line (Germany), with stylised design by Bjorn Wiinblad.
The shape of the vase is 'Arundo' and it's stamped on the base with both the logo and a no 27.

I believe it's from the Commedia dell' Arte series, and the imagery depicts two musicians, one with a flute, the other with a lute like string instrument. They're brightly coloured with gold trim. The sitting figure looks to be a jester/harlequin, while the flamboyant woman wears a big dress and hat.

It's 12cm tall - suitable for a small bunch of flowers, or just for display.

Circa early 1960s.

Great condition with no chips or cracks.
The reverse has a manufacturing flaw to the rim where the white glaze did not cover - see photos.
